Job Responsibilities

Pennoni is currently seeking a Staff Roadway Engineer to assist on multi-discipline designs for public infrastructure and private site development projects. This position may also require supervision of support staff and in all aspects of projects, including conceptual / planning, preliminary design, detailed design, construction documentation, permitting documents and engineering reports. Responsibilities include, but are not limited to, the following :

  • Prepare roadway design plans for NCDOT projects
  • Review local municipal and NCDOT roadway design standards
  • Familiarity with general utility design along primary and secondary roadways
  • Reviewing and understanding transportation design plans for roadway improvements
  • Attend and conduct meetings with client and other design team members
  • Perform design quantity take-offs, and develop opinions of construction cost
  • Prepare encroachment agreements
  • Present technical information to demonstrate compliance with client requirements and / or regulatory requirements
  • Complete tasks and assignments as directed by other Project Managers within the time frames and budgetary constraints of the project
  • Serve as a mentor for less experienced staff
Required Attributes
  • Bachelor’s Degree in Civil Engineering, Construction Engineering, or similar
  • FE / EIT Certification
  • 4+ years of professional experience working in roadway design
  • Proficient in MS Office 365 (Outlook, Excel, and Word), PDF editing (Bluebeam, Adobe, etc.), and Micro Station
Preferred Attributes
  • Professional Engineer (PE) Certification in North Carolina
  • Strong organization and communication skills
  • Be able to work independently as well as in a team
  • Proven ability to work collaboratively in a team environment with minimal supervision
  • Desire and ability to manage and lead less experienced staff
